01 / Probability

The middle is not luckier; it is more represented.

With two dice, a central total can be produced by more combinations than an edge total. Seeing the combinations is more useful than repeating a slogan about odds.

03 / Product craft

Limits are interface decisions.

A budget field, a cool-off control and a visible close state are not compliance decoration. They shape how much pressure a product puts on a player during a session.

  • Make the stop action easy to find.
  • Avoid urgency language around a stake.
  • Keep the last result visible without pushing another round.
